Mid-Game Economy Management

By Ante 2-4, you should have accumulated a decent amount of money, marking a crucial juncture for economic decision-making. This is the prime time to carefully consider your spending strategy. You'll face a constant choice: invest in immediate, tangible upgrades to your current hand or save your funds for potentially more impactful, game-changing Jokers that might appear later in the shop. It's often more advantageous to acquire a cheap Joker that provides a consistent, reliable bonus, even if it's not flashy, rather than holding out indefinitely for a legendary Joker that may never materialize. This proactive approach can build a solid foundation for your scoring potential.

Furthermore, Booster Packs become increasingly valuable during this phase. While they can be a gamble, the potential to draw powerful Jokers, Tarot Cards, or even Planet Cards can drastically alter the trajectory of your run. Prioritize buying Booster Packs when you have a surplus of cash and your current hand is reasonably stable. Remember, the goal is to create a synergistic engine. Don't overlook the power of collecting interest. If you have a healthy bankroll, strategically delaying purchases to accrue interest can provide a sificant financial boost for future, more substantial investments. This interest mechanic, combined with judicious spending on immediate hand improvements or long-term Joker investments, is key to navigating the mid-game economy effectively and setting yourself up for success in the later, more challenging antes.
